Possible intoxicated driver in white truck on I-70 near Zumbehl RdSt Charles County MO

audio iconAlcohol Violation
Zumbehl Rd, Missouri

A white Ford F-150 was reported as a possible intoxicated driver traveling westbound on I-70 near Zumbehl Road in St. Charles County. The vehicle was previously stopped in St. Louis County after the driver underwent a breath test. The driver was seen swerving on the roadway but could maintain their lane. The vehicle last exited near Zumbehl Road.
